Output 84551bed60636c7a09608551a15906b1428e43de48a66817774557ff50dd5831:31

value
88554923
script pubkey
OP_0 OP_PUSHBYTES_32 cbf30cf725d844816f8e1a703cc8fde41fbd36d3c2063e3c84160e67fe08315b
address
bc1qe0eseae9mpzgzmuwrfcrej8aus0m6dkncgrru0yyzc8x0lsgx9dszjy8qc
transaction
84551bed60636c7a09608551a15906b1428e43de48a66817774557ff50dd5831
spent
true